Acord v. Acord (Griffen, J.) CA99-1145

Life estates -- Limited interest; improvements made at tenant's own risk; chancellor erred in applying betterment statute to appellee; reversed & remanded where chancellor misapplied law. [HTML, WP5.1]

Alltel Ark., Inc. v. Arkansas Public Serv. Comm'n (Meads, J.) CA98-1362

Public Service Commission -- Appellee's explanation not considered; no supporting evidence in record; no finding on controverted issue; appellate court unable to decide appeal; portions of order reversed & remanded; Commission ordered to render adequate findings. [HTML, WP5.1]

Hickmon v. Hickmon (Roaf, J.) CA99-1300

Parent & child -- Relocation dispute; removal of child from state by custodial parent; appellant failed to prove real advantage to child; trial court's denial of appellant's petition not clearly erroneous. [HTML, WP5.1]

Oliver v. Oliver (Koonce, J.) CA99-862

Divorce -- Decree & property-settlement agreement unambiguous; affirmed. [HTML, WP5.1]
